Vistara's Mumbai-Frankfurt flight diverted to Turkey after security threat

Vistara flight UK 27 operating from Mumbai to Frankfurt on 06 September 2024 has been diverted to Turkey due to a security concern

A Vistara flight operating from Mumbai to Frankfurt in Germany was diverted to Erzurum Airport in Turkey due to a security threat. In a post on X, Vistara posted,"Flight UK27 from Mumbai to Frankfurt (BOM-FRA) has been diverted to Turkey (Erzurum airport) due to security reasons and has landed safely at 1905 hours."

"Vistara flight UK 27 operating from Mumbai to Frankfurt on 06 September 2024 has been diverted to Turkey due to a security concern that was noted by our crew while onboard. The aircraft has safely landed at the Erzurum Airport. As per protocol, the relevant authorities were immediately alerted and we are fully cooperating with the security agencies to complete the mandatory security checks. At Vistara, the safety and security of our customers, crew, and aircraft remain our highest priority," said a spokesperson of the airline.

The spokesperson said that the crew onboard the flight noted a security concern and after that the relevant authorities were informed. According to sources, all 247 passengers on board are safe and local authorities are in touch with them. Sources confirmed that emergency landing was triggered by a message discovered on a piece of paper mentioning a bomb threat was found by a passenger. The passenger handed it over to a crew member and the pilot was alerted. After landing, all passengers were safely evacuated from the aircraft.

Earlier, this month an IndiGo flight from Jabalpur in Madhya Pradesh to Hyderabad in Telangana was diverted to Nagpur following a bomb threat. In a statement, IndiGo said its flight 6E-7308, scheduled from Jabalpur to Hyderabad, got diverted to Nagpur International Airport on Sunday morning due to a bomb threat message on board the aircraft. "Upon landing, all passengers were disembarked, and mandatory security checks were promptly initiated. Passengers were provided with assistance and refreshments," the statement added.

A police official said the bomb threat message was written on a piece of paper, which was found in the bathroom of the aircraft. However, nothing suspicious was found after a thorough check by security agencies, the official added.
